After low-scoring totals in their previous four matchup, ConVal brought some dynamite into their most recent game. They strolled past the Hollis-Brookline Cavaliers with points to spare on Friday, taking the game 33-14. The win was a breath of fresh air for the Cougars as it put an end to their four-game losing streak.
ConVal's victory was their first in the league, bumping their league record up to 1-3 and their overall record up to 2-4. As for Hollis-Brookline, their loss dropped their record down to 1-5.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ming contests. ConVal will venture away from home to challenge Merrimack Valley at 6:30 p.m. on Friday. The Cougars will be up against the Pride's rather soft defense (which has allowed 35.8 points per matchup),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ance. As for Hollis-Brookline, they will head out to face off against Pembroke at 2:30 p.m. on Saturday.
